About this service

Sheet metal roofing involves custom-formed metal sheets tailored to your building’s dimensions. This is often seen on architectural projects requiring a seamless look or long-lasting durability. You need this service if you are looking for a high-performance roof that minimizes the number of seams where leaks could start. The cost typically varies based on the type of metal used, such as aluminum or steel, and the fabrication work required.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

How does a standing seam metal roof perform in Atlanta's climate?

Standing seam metal roofs perform very well in Atlanta's climate. They are durable and can withstand heavy rain and occasional high winds common in Georgia. Their sleek design helps water and debris slide off easily. Metal roofs also reflect solar heat, which can help reduce cooling costs in the hot Atlanta summers. Installation is key to their long-term performance.

Do I need a special roofing nailer for corrugated metal roofing in Atlanta?

For corrugated metal roofing in Atlanta, a standard roofing nailer might not be ideal. You'll likely need a specialized screw gun with a setting for metal roofing screws. These screws have rubber washers to create a watertight seal. Using the wrong fasteners can lead to leaks and damage. A professional installer will have the correct tools and expertise for your Atlanta project.
